Output 63f87854afa1bcc170c10678f2f70624b51e0f371e6f3dd82ddb2e0b7b232c0e:0

value
65505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201118e633be75e66a5f918bf8526ef1488f24ce OP_EQUAL
address
34ca2cyADcfPTfz2NBUURd8waSt71QnaUR
transaction
63f87854afa1bcc170c10678f2f70624b51e0f371e6f3dd82ddb2e0b7b232c0e
spent
true